Apoptotic Pathway Induced by Dominant Negative ATM Gene in CT-26 Colon Cancer Cells
Jung Chang Lee, Ho Keun Yi, Sun Young Kim, Dae Yeol Lee, Pyoung Han Hwang, Jin Woo Park
Clin Exp Pediatr. 2003;46(7):679-686.   Published online July 15, 2003
Purpose : Ataxia telangiectasia mutated(ATM) is involved in DNA damage responses at different cell cycle checkpoints, and signalling pathways associated with regulation of apoptosis in response to ionizing radiation(IR). However, the signaling pathway that underlies IR-induced apoptosis in ATM cells has remained unknown. Novel Gap Junction Molecules, Connexin 37, Enhances the Bystander Effect in HSVtk/GCV Gene Therapy
Sun Young Kim, Ho Keun Yi, Jung Chang Lee, Dong Jin Hwang, Pyoung Han Hwang, Dae Yeol Lee, Soo Chul Cho
Clin Exp Pediatr. 2003;46(6):541-547.   Published online June 15, 2003
Purpose : Gap junction intercellular communication(GJIC) is an important mechanism of the bystander effect in herpes simplex thymidine kinase/ganciclovir(HSVtk/GCV) gene therapy Therefore, we attempted to enhance the bystander effect in vitro by exogenous overexpressing connexin 37(Cx37) in cells to increase GJIC.
